在 Linux 上(如果有通用答案,则还包括其他类 Unix 操作系统),是否有一种简单的方法可以获取time
仍在运行的进程的类似于命令的输出(当前实时、用户和系统 CPU 使用率总计)?
答案1
是的,请查看/proc/$PID/stat
,应该有您需要的内容。字段在中定义man proc
。如果您关心这些,还可以提取内存使用情况和故障信息。
在 Linux 上(如果有通用答案,则还包括其他类 Unix 操作系统),是否有一种简单的方法可以获取time
仍在运行的进程的类似于命令的输出(当前实时、用户和系统 CPU 使用率总计)?
是的,请查看/proc/$PID/stat
,应该有您需要的内容。字段在中定义man proc
。如果您关心这些,还可以提取内存使用情况和故障信息。